GitHub Gists - GitHub Gists is another popular choice for sharing code snippets. It allows you to create public or private gists and integrates well with GitHub repositories. Ideal for open source enthusiasts, Gists makes it easy to share code with the community or keep it private for personal use.

Pastebin - Known for its simplicity, Pastebin allows users to paste and share text or code snippets quickly. It's widely used for sharing logs, configuration files, and code samples. While it doesn't have as many features as other platforms, its ease of use makes it a favorite for many.

CodePen - Perfect for front-end developers, CodePen offers a platform to showcase and share HTML, CSS, and JavaScript code. It's a great way to experiment with new ideas and get feedback from the community. CodePen's live preview feature helps you see changes in real-time, making it an excellent tool for web developers.

JSFiddle - JSFiddle provides a simple and effective way to test and share JavaScript, HTML, and CSS snippets. Its collaborative features allow multiple developers to work on the same project simultaneously. JSFiddle's intuitive interface makes it a go-to platform for quick prototyping and sharing.

Bitbucket Snippets - Bitbucket Snippets is an extension of the Bitbucket platform that allows you to share code snippets and files. It supports both public and private snippets, making it versatile for different needs. If you're already using Bitbucket for version control, this feature is a natural addition to your workflow.

Ideone - Ideone is an online compiler and debugging tool which also serves as a code sharing platform. It supports over 60 programming languages and allows you to run code directly from the browser. This makes Ideone a useful tool for learning and testing code snippets.
